Immunogen:
This ZMPSTE24 antibody is generated from rabbits immunized with a KLH conjugated synthetic peptide between 404-433 amino acids from the C-terminal region of human ZMPSTE24.

Background:
This gene encodes a member of the peptidase M48A family.The encoded protein is a zinc metalloproteinase involved in the twostep post-translational proteolytic cleavage of carboxy terminalresidues of farnesylated prelamin A to form mature lamin A.Mutations in this gene have been associated with mandibuloacraldysplasia and restrictive dermopathy.
